Electro galvanized coils offer several benefits:
1. **Corrosion Resistance**: The electroplating process applies a uniform zinc coating, providing excellent protection against rust and corrosion, which is crucial for extending the lifespan of the steel.
2. **Smooth Finish**: The electro galvanization process results in a smooth, aesthetically pleasing finish, making these coils ideal for applications where appearance is important, such as in consumer goods and automotive parts.
3. **Paintability**: The smooth surface of electro galvanized coils enhances paint adhesion, allowing for high-quality finishes in painted products.
4. **Formability**: These coils maintain the formability of the base steel, making them suitable for complex shapes and deep drawing applications without compromising the integrity of the material.
5. **Weldability**: Electro galvanized coils can be easily welded, which is beneficial in manufacturing processes that require joining of parts.
6. **Consistent Coating**: The electroplating process ensures a consistent zinc coating thickness, providing uniform protection and performance across the entire surface of the coil.
7. **Cost-Effective**: While offering superior corrosion resistance, electro galvanized coils are often more cost-effective than other corrosion-resistant materials, such as stainless steel.
8. **Versatility**: These coils are used in a wide range of industries, including automotive, construction, appliances, and electronics, due to their protective properties and adaptability to various applications.
9. **Environmental Benefits**: The electro galvanization process is more environmentally friendly compared to hot-dip galvanization, as it produces fewer emissions and waste.
10. **Recyclability**: Like other steel products, electro galvanized coils are recyclable, contributing to sustainable manufacturing practices.
Overall, electro galvanized coils provide a combination of durability, aesthetic appeal, and cost efficiency, making them a preferred choice in many industrial applications.
